With Disney+ as 100M+ Subscriber base, the Mouse House doesn’t give in to Cinemark and walks away from Raya movie fans. Theaters open up and are filling up, but the capacity holds back healthy returns for distributors, so studios are finding pre-pandemic deals may fall short.
Disney also dominates in SVOD space. Netting half the number of Netflix subs in 12 months and crashing the server with Wandavision Finale. “Disney’s vision complements the distribution formats with the content.” - Tim Thompson
Universal takes two, with FF9 by pushing the release date after July 4th. And Peacock TV, Comcast/Universal NBC’s AVOD platform, shows a big (but “projected”) loss with $914M loss in launching the platform brings on only $118M in ad revenue.
